Inspection on 8/8/2024
High Priority
5
Intermediate
3
Basic
16
Total
24
Disposition: Met Inspection Standards
Inspection Details:
- 23-24-4:Basic - Buildup of food debris/soil residue on equipment door handles. Cooler handles soiled
- 24-06-4:Basic - Clean utensils or equipment stored in dirty drawer or rack. Clean equipment stored on soiled racks above triple sink **Repeat Violation**
- 14-09-4:Basic - Cutting board has cut marks and is no longer cleanable. **Repeat Violation**
- 14-11-5:Basic - Equipment in poor repair. Walk in cooler door **Repeat Violation**
- 36-73-4:Basic - Floor soiled/has accumulation of debris. Accumulation of grease under cook line Under coolers at inside bar **Repeat Violation**
- 08B-38-4:Basic - Food stored on floor. Cooking oil and cans of corned beef on floor in dry storage **Repeat Violation**
- 36-24-5:Basic - Hole in or other damage to wall. Hole in wall men's restroom
- 10-20-4:Basic - In-use tongs stored on equipment door handle between uses. Oven door handles **Repeat Violation**
- 31B-04-4:Basic - No handwashing sign provided at a hand sink used by food employees. Men's restroom
- 23-03-4:Basic - Nonfood-contact surface soiled with grease, food debris, dirt, slime or dust. Cooler gaskets soiled Hood filters soiled **Repeat Violation**
- 08B-61-5:Basic - Outdoor ice machine with no overhead protection. Overhead protection of outdoor ice machine was damaged as a result of previous Tropical Storm Debby on 8/4/24.
- 22-16-4:Basic - Reach-in cooler interior/shelves have accumulation of soil residues. Beer cooler at bar
- 36-50-4:Basic - Unclean building components, attachments or fixtures. Fan covers soiled in walk in cooler **Repeat Violation**
- 08B-62-4:Basic - Unprotected ice machine in a customer/nonsecure area. Outdoor ice machine not secured when not in use, operator locked during inspection **Repeat Violation**
- 36-02-5:Basic - Unsealed concrete floor in food preparation, food storage, warewashing area or bathroom. Walk in cooler **Repeat Violation**
- 14-17-4:Basic - Walk-in cooler/freezer shelves with rust that has pitted the surface. **Repeat Violation**
- 22-48-5:High Priority - Establishment using a sanitizer solution that does not meet the requirements specified in 40 CFR 180. Only use single-service items to serve food to customers until approved sanitizer is available for warewashing. Triple sink set up with unapproved chlorine (laundry use only), staff replaced with approved quaternary tablets) **Corrected On-Site**
- 50-17-3:High Priority - Operating with an expired Division of Hotels and Restaurants license. License renewed during inspection **Corrected On-Site**
- 08A-02-6:High Priority - Raw animal food stored over or with ready-to-eat food in a freezer - not all products commercially packaged. Unpackaged raw sausage over potatoes and vegetables in reach in freezer
- 08A-05-6:High Priority - Raw animal food stored over/not properly separated from ready-to-eat food. Raw beef over cooked chicken, order corrected **Corrected On-Site** **Repeat Violation**
- 03A-02-5:High Priority - Time/temperature control for safety food cold held at greater than 41 degrees Fahrenheit. Reach in cooler across from cook line: diced tomatoes (53F - Cold Holding); shredded cheese (56F - Cold Holding); hard boiled eggs (52F - Cold Holding); turkey (53F - Cold Holding), items moved to reach in freezer. Retemp: all items at or below 43F. **Corrected On-Site**
- 22-02-4:Intermediate - Food-contact surface soiled with food debris, mold-like substance or slime. Stained cutting boards Accumulation of grease on grill/stove surface Accumulation of grease and food residue on fryers baskets
- 16-37-1:Intermediate - No chemical test kit provided when using sanitizer at three-compartment sink/warewashing machine or wiping cloths.
- 53B-13-5:Intermediate - Proof of required state approved employee training not available for some employees. To order approved program food safety material, call DBPR contracted provider: Florida Restaurant and Lodging Association (SafeStaff) 866-372-7233. **Repeat Violation**
Food safety inspection conducted on 8/8/2024 revealed 24 total violations (5 high priority, 3 intermediate, 16 basic).
